About 01 Numbers
These numbers refer to specific locations in the UK and are frequently used by residential and commercial properties. Also known as as 'basic rate', 'local rate', or 'national rate' numbers, the call costs for these geographic numbers are predicated on the time of day. Several service providers offer call packages that provide free calls during designated times. Call costs from mobile phones are subject to the chosen calling plan, with a number of plans incorporating these numbers in their free call packages.
